The Hallmark channel in the United Kingdom started showing it round about October 2004. They showed the first seven episodes and then stopped showing it, saying, they were having trouble getting the episodes and said they would start showing it again in 2005. I couldn’t wait for that so got the Season one region 1 DVD set. They did start showing it in 2005 and showed two episodes a week and did season 1 & 2 in one go. I contacted them to ask whether they were going to show season 3 and they said they weren’t going to as the show wasn’t that popular. Therefore I really need the other seasons to be released on DVD so I can see the final season! I may contact Hallmark again as they’re re-running it at present and the trailer for it says it’s one of their most popular shows, so maybe they will change their mind (or maybe it’s just to plug the programme). I can’t understand why it isn’t popular in the UK, if, indeed, that is the case.
